Washington Metropolitan Area Transit Authority 3100-3199 are 2018 New Flyer XN40 buses. These buses replaced a few 2000 Orion Vs and began replacing the 2005 Orion VII CNGs. 3100-3149 features a Pike Ride sticker near the front door of the bus that are intended to be used for the Pike Ride routes (16 lines) but are commonly found on every route. Some buses were also wrapped with a full Pike Ride wrap around the bus but have been since removed.[1]
Engine | Transmission | Seating | Destination Sign |
---|---|---|---|
Cummins Westport ISL G NZ | Allison B400R | 40: American Seating InSight | Luminator Horizon |
